Medium Earth Orbit (MEO) satellites are a type of satellite that orbits the Earth at an altitude of approximately 2,000 to 36,000 kilometers, which is lower than geostationary orbit but higher than low Earth orbit. MEO satellites are designed to provide global coverage and are used for a variety of applications, including navigation, communication, and Earth observation.

The use of MEO satellites has several advantages over traditional geostationary satellites. One of the main benefits is the reduced latency, which is the time it takes for a signal to travel from the Earth to the satellite and back. MEO satellites have a latency of around 20-30 milliseconds, which is significantly lower than the 250-300 milliseconds experienced with geostationary satellites. This makes MEO satellites ideal for applications that require real-time communication, such as video conferencing and online gaming.

Another advantage of MEO satellites is their ability to provide global coverage with a smaller number of satellites. A constellation of MEO satellites can provide coverage of the entire Earth, whereas a single geostationary satellite can only cover a specific region. This makes MEO satellites more cost-effective and efficient for providing global communication services. MEO satellites are also more resistant to interference and jamming, which makes them more secure and reliable.

MEO satellites have a wide range of applications, including navigation, communication, and Earth observation. They are used in GPS systems, such as the US GPS and the European Galileo system, to provide location information and timing signals. They are also used for communication services, such as satellite broadband and mobile phone networks. In addition, MEO satellites are used for Earth observation, such as weather forecasting and environmental monitoring.
